Fonterra Co-operative Group is striding towards its climate goals and operational resilience, with $150 million in electrification investments planned across New Zealand’s North Island over the next 18 months.

Idyll Wine Company has acquired Top Shelf International’s Campbellfield factory for $8 million. The sale includes all operational and production equipment, including bottling and canning lines, brewhouse and distillery.

Wine Australia’s latest Export Report has shown a significant rise in Australian wine exports in 2024, increasing by 34 per cent in value to $2.55 billion and by 7 per cent in volume to 649 million litres across the period from 1 January 2024-31 December 2024.
